George has been experiencing hearing loss for the last
few years from all his years in a rattling chip truck.

I know from my Father's experience that hearing aids
can be so costly as to be prohibitive for most people.

George did some research online
 after having a hearing exam when we were back in PA last year.
The doctor back there gave him his exam results,
but his estimate was over $6,000!
Even with payments, it made it way too costly.

George finally found hearing aids (the same ones he was fitted with)
online at a site called HearStore for a fraction of the cost!
He purchased them for $2800.00, with a promotional $1,000 off.
They set up a $150/month no interest payment plan as well.
They contacted a local audiologist in Salinas,
who then fitted him with the hearing aids the Hear Store sent them.


They are inconspicuous, tucked inside his ear,
with the small wire over his ear.


 He absolutely loves them! 
There's quite a difference in his ability to hear things.
George even said on a walk recently how he's hearing birds
chirping in the trees that he couldn't hear well before!

6 year recap

Greenfield, CA

It doesn't feel like we're beginning our 7th year of full timing.

October 1, 2012 we set sail from Pennsylvania
to see what we could see.

As we look behind at our 6th year on the road,
we wanted to recap some of the facts and figures.

Total miles towing this year:  4,354
Total miles driven this year:  12,139

As most everyone knows,
we've been sitting fairly stationary,
keeping an eye on Mom, and helping her
on our days off.

We've been workamping for site and pay at
Yanks RV Resort in Greenfield, CA.
George and I have been here working off and on 
since 9/30/16!

We haven't traveled extensively like we have in the past,
however in September last year
we took a two month 'vacation' across country.

For the past fiscal year we spent:

Fuel $3,383.78

Campground Fees $397.92

Most of the fuel cost was traveling from CA to PA and back,
as well as the campground fees.
Our normal diesel cost per month averages around $150.00.
We use my Mom's car occasionally, saving us some money.

Repairs to truck/RV $671.71*
*Includes oil change and new shocks for truck.

Cell phones/internet/TV $3,455.47

Groceries/Entertainment/Dining Out $11,336.42

Insurance -
Truck/RV $2,145.05
Health Insurance $3,119.46*

*Health Insurance
Includes my ACA insurance premiums,
George's Medicare supplemental,vision insurance,
and prescription plan and prescriptions.
Although my Blue Shield plan is an HMO that I can only use in Texas,
the doctor I see here has not charged me for any of my visits
 including lab work!!
She's my Mom's doctor as well, and George really likes her too.
God bless her!

We have other expenditures, but these are the major ones.

Our pay here at Yank's in addition to the free site
has enabled us to pay extra on our RV payment.
We still watch our budget, staying out of debt except for the RV.
